Triggers in sql pdf file

Download file pdf my sql manual my sql manual manually installing and configuring mysql 5. For example, sending an email from sql server could be done with a trigger based on some anticipated event. Sql server triggers are special stored procedures that are executed automatically in response to the database object, database, and server events. International technical support organization external procedures, triggers, and userdefined functions on ibm db2 for i april 2016 sg24650303. Understanding sql server inserted and deleted tables for dml triggers foreign key vs. Sql server azure sql database azure synapse analytics sql dw parallel data warehouse creates a dml, ddl, or logon trigger. An after trigger is the original mechanism that sql server created to provide an automated response to data modifications. You can choose the event upon which the trigger needs to be fired and the timing of the execution. On update insert trigger create a csv file solutions. The common one is using auditing triggers in sql server databases. This site is like a library, use search box in the widget to get ebook that you want.

Sql, where x represents a digit that is determined by the number of files by the same name that already exist in the output directory. Hello, i am faily new at using triggers with sql 2000 and i was wondering if you guys could give me an example on how to get a trigger on a table on update or insert that will generate a csv file and export it to a drive somewhere or something of the sort. Triggers are stored programs, which are automatically executed or fired when some events occur. Instead, store the path to the binary or image file in the database and use that as a pointer to the actual file stored on a server. After triggers in sql server are not supported on views so, use them on tables only. The select statement day 3 expressions, conditions, and operators. If this works isolatedly, it should work within a trigger too. Teach yourself sql in 21 days, second edition table of contents.

Create trigger transactsql sql server microsoft docs. Might be, that you are awaiting a file in your local cdrive, but the file is written to the servers machine acutally. Move access data to a sql server database by using the upsizing wizard. A trigger is a stored procedure in database which automatically invokes whenever a special event in the database occurs. An sql server trigger is a tsql procedure that is invoked when a specified database activity occurs triggers can be used to. Ql tutorial gives unique learning on structured query language and it helps to make practice on sql commands which provides immediate results. The article is dedicated to main types of sql server triggers. Introduction week 1 at a glance day 1 introduction to sql day 2 introduction to the query. How to create and use dml triggers in sql server using. Introduction to triggers in sql types of triggers in sql. First thing first, a little background on triggers. Trigger is stored into database and invoked repeatedly, when specific condition match. Reading and writing files in sql server using tsql sql server provides several standard techniques by which to read and write to files but, just occasionally, they arent quite up to the task at hand especially when dealing with large strings or relatively unstructured data. Sql server provides two virtual tables that are available specifically for triggers called inserted and deleted tables.

The code to be excecuted in case of a trigger can be defined as per the requirement. Although often maligned, in certain circumstances they can be very helpful once you get to know them. After delete triggers in sql server tutorial gateway. Disparadores en sql server pdf additional information. It explains the various kinds of dml triggers after triggers and instead of triggers along with their variants and describes how each of them works. Anywhere pdf tiff tiff pdf in a plsql program where an executable. The afterfor triggers in sql runs after an insert, delete, or an update on a table. Move access data to a sql server database by using the.

A trigger is a special kind of a stored procedure that executes in response to certain action on the table like insertion, deletion or updation of data. Oracle engine invokes automatically whenever a specified event occurs. And here, we will modify the trigger that we created in our previous example. Sql procedures, triggers, and userdefined functions on. For example, you can run a trigger to notify accounts receivable when payment on an invoice is late.

A trigger is a special type of stored procedure that automatically runs when an event occurs in the database server. Pdf version of tsql tutorial with content of stored procedures, sql tutorial, cursors, triggers, views, functions, data types, table joins, transactions, interview questions. In microsoft sql server, triggers are very useful thing for manage database connection. Sql is a language of database, it includes database creation, deletion, fetching rows and modifying rows etc. Sql server uses these tables to capture the data of the modified row. Load data from pdf file into sql server 2017 with r. This lesson describes all ihe sql statements that you need to perform these actions. Practice writing comments in stored procedures, triggers and sql batches, whenever. Data manipulation language dml triggers which are invoked automatically in response to insert, update, and delete events against tables. Triggers in sql server tutorial pdf education articles. Sql triggers can be created using the sql create trigger statement. From the file menu, select new to open the new document wizard. You can change trigger mode activatedeactivate but you cant explicitly run. When using this triggers delete trigger, update trigger and insert trigger are mostly using triggers.

Auditing triggers in sql server databases solution center. International technical support organization sql procedures, triggers, and functions on ibm db2 for i april 2016. It means, before the trigger starts running, all the operations should execute, and the statement has to succeed in the constraint check as well. Part of the task when using sql to create a trigger involves specifying the name of the trigger, what table it is attached to, when it should be activated before insert, after update etc, and finally what actions it should perform. Triggers are stored programs that are fired by oracle engine automatically when dml statements like insert, update, delete are executed on the table or some events occur. Sql procedures, triggers, and functions on ibm db2 for i jim bainbridge hernando bedoya rob bestgen mike cain dan cruikshank jim denton doug mack tom mckinley simona pacchiarini. For example, a trigger can be invoked when a row is inserted into a specified table or when certain table columns are being updated. Sql server azure sql database azure synapse analytics sql dw parallel data warehouse this topic describes how to create a transactsql dml trigger by using sql server management studio and by using the transactsql create trigger statement. A trigger is a special type of a database object which is automatically executed upon certain conditions e.

There are two clear scenarios when triggers are the best choice. External procedures, triggers, and userdefined function. By using a trigger, you can keep track of the changes on a given table by writing a log record with information about who. Enforce business rules set complex default values update views implement referential integrity actions sql server only supports instead of and after triggers. In this article, we will focus on a case with tsql. A trigger in sql is a special kind of stored procedure or stored program that is automatically fired or executed when some event insert, delete and. Mysql triggers in mysql, a trigger is a stored program invoked automatically in response to an event such as insert, update, or delete that occurs in the associated table. When a create trigger statement commits, the compiled plsql code, called p code for pseudocode, is stored in the database and the source code of the trigger is flushed from the shared pool. This parameter applies only to create and alter statements for sql procedures, functions, or triggers in the source file. File type pdf pl sql user guide looking at database management basics and sql using the mysql rdbms. Select specify user name and password database authentication.

Sql is an ansi american national standards institute standard language, but there are many different versions of the sql language. This example shows how to insert all the deleted records into the employee audit table triggered table using the after delete triggers in sql server. This value will be used when creating the program for the sql routine. Oracle stores plsql triggers in compiled form, just like stored procedures. I am going to explain sql trigger in a way that includes a basic definition, types, pros, and cons, when to use a sql trigger. Once this data repository is created, you can perform free text search and text mining related processing tasks on this data. This article gives a brief introduction about triggers in sql server 20002005. For example, you can define a trigger that is invoked automatically before a new row is inserted into a table. Tutorial pdf will helpful for database management dbms and data and information. After triggers fire after the data modification statement completes but before the statements work is committed to the databases. Plsql triggers in this chapter, we will discuss triggers in plsql. Click download or read online button to get triggers book now. I want to export data of inserted table temporary table have note of inserted data of the table to.